It's been for years that QMenu's rounded corners in qmacstyle_mac were
done via QWidget::setMask(QRegion). Unfortunately, QRegion mask does not
work well with retina displays and also does not support translucency.
That's why in this change we explicitly make QMenu's background
transparent and then draw a rectangle with rounded corners in
QMacStyle::drawPrimitive(PE_PanelMenu). This not only gives much better
result than the mask-based approach, but also de-HIThemes QMenu.
As a consequence, QComboBoxPrivateContainer doesn't get any mask from
QMacStyle anymore. Therefore, when the mask is empty, we need to paint
PE_PanelMenu before invoking QFrame's paint event handler.

MariaDB allows only a single call to mysql_library_end(), all subsequent calls
to mysql_library_init() or any other API call will fail. Since QMYSQLDriver
calls mysql_library_end() function whenever the refcount drops to 0, this
breaks applications that close and reopen database connections.
This change registers call to mysql_library_init() via qAddPostRoutine()
when compiled against MariaDB, so that we only call it once.

The call to CGImageCreateCopyWithColorSpace took a naked toCGImage(),
which left the resulting CGImageRef without a release, causing the
extra ref by toCGImage() to never be derefed, and a subsequent detach
of the image data on the next paint event.
Wrapping the call in a QCFType<CGImageRef> solves the problem. The code
has also been moved directly into QCocoaBackingStore::flush(), as there
is no need to keep the CGImageRef a member.
A local autorelease pool has been added to QCocoaBackingStore::flush(),
so that the NSImage used for blitting the backingstore is released upon
exit of the function, thereby releasing the corresponding CGImageRef.
Note that for layered mode, the QImage will still detach, as the view's
layer.contents property keeps a reference to the image data until being
replaced in a subsequent flush.

Window icons on macOS are tied to document windows, and should not show
up unless a represented filename has also been set according to the HIG.
We follow this, and no longer create a document button based on the window
title if one did no exists. We also fall back to using the filename of
the file if a title has not been set, including being able to restore
this default title after setting a custom title.
The icon is no longer reset to nil after setting a QIcon(), which would
remove the icon completely, but instead we restore the default behavior
of showing the default filetype icon of the file.
Finally, the two callbacks in QNSWindowDelegate dealing with the document
icon/title popups and drags have been taught to look for spaces in the
represented filename. This allows clients who really want the old
behavior of setting an icon without caring about the filename to set
the filename to a single space character, which will prevent the
dropdowna and drag from occurring.
The reason for not tying this behavior to the existence of the file in
the filesystem is that being able to represent a file that is yet to
be saved is a valid usecase.

The backing store was assigned the sRGB color profile
as an unintended side effect of the QImage -> CGImage
conversion function refactoring in ac899f6d. This
caused Core Graphics to add a color convert step, which
in some cases caused performance issues.
Restore fast, previous behavior by assigning the target
display color profile to the backing store image.
Color correctness is still a goal, but we’ll add API
for it and make it opt-in.

When the focus object inside a window changes and we are
currently composing text, we have to cancel composition to avoid
getting into an inconsistent state. This is what already happens
if you switch to a different top level window.
Note: Because we limit the user's ability to change focus inside
a window when composing text, this would only happen under
certain circumstances, such as creating a new MDI window with
an editor while still composing text in a previous one.
[ChangeLog][macOS] Switching focus objects inside a top level window
while composing text using dead keys or input method events would
leave the application in an inconsistent state. The composition
now automatically cancels when the focus object changes.
